Cozy and Intimate:
If you’re looking to create a warm and inviting ambiance in your living room, opt for curtains that exude coziness. Soft, plush fabrics like velvet or suede can instantly add a sense of comfort to the space. Choose rich, deep colors such as burgundy, navy, or chocolate brown to enhance the intimate feel. For an extra touch of coziness, consider layering curtains with sheer panels or adding decorative elements like tassels or fringe.
Bright and Airy:
For those who prefer a light and breezy atmosphere, sheer curtains are an excellent choice. Sheer fabrics allow natural light to filter into the room while still providing a level of privacy. Opt for crisp, white curtains to create a fresh and airy feel, or choose soft pastel hues for a subtle pop of color. To enhance the sense of openness, consider installing floor-to-ceiling curtains or opting for curtain rods with minimalistic hardware.
Formal and Elegant:
If you’re aiming for a more formal and sophisticated look in your living room, consider luxurious fabrics like silk or satin. These fabrics drape beautifully and add a touch of opulence to any space. Choose curtains in rich, jewel-toned colors like emerald green, royal blue, or deep purple to create a sense of drama and elegance. To complete the look, opt for ornate curtain rods and accessories like tassels or decorative finials.
Enhancing Natural Light:
Natural light can have a significant impact on the mood of your living room, so it’s essential to choose curtains that complement and enhance this feature. Opt for lightweight fabrics like linen or cotton that allow sunlight to filter into the space while still providing privacy when needed. Consider installing curtains with tie-backs or holdbacks to frame the windows and maximize natural light during the day.
Adding Privacy:
Privacy is another crucial factor to consider when choosing living room curtains, especially if your windows face a busy street or neighboring houses. Thicker fabrics like velvet or blackout curtains can help block out unwanted light and noise while providing an extra layer of privacy. Choose curtains with a tight weave and a lining to ensure maximum opacity and insulation.
Harmonizing with Existing Decor:
When selecting curtains for your living room, it’s essential to consider how they will harmonize with the existing decor. Take into account the color palette, furniture styles, and overall theme of the room. Curtains should complement other design elements rather than compete with them. If you have bold or patterned furniture, opt for solid-colored curtains to create balance. Conversely, if your furniture is more understated, consider curtains with a subtle pattern or texture to add visual interest.
Experimenting with Patterns and Textures:
Don’t be afraid to experiment with patterns and textures when choosing living room curtains. Bold patterns can add personality and character to the space, while textured fabrics like jacquard or tweed can create visual depth and dimension. Mix and match different patterns and textures to create a dynamic and eclectic look, or stick to a cohesive theme for a more polished appearance. Just be sure to keep the scale of the patterns in proportion to the size of the room to avoid overwhelming the space.
